## v2.8.1 — Chronoline scheduler

Renamed `CRON_SKEW_LIMIT` to `CRON_DRIFT_TOLERANCE_MS` after the drift investigation on the Veltro batch tier. Old name was ambiguous: ops read it as seconds, scheduler parsed milliseconds, so jobs fired up to 40s late. Migration shim logs a deprecation warning through v2.9. Drift probe now signs its heartbeat payloads, so the worker env needs the signing secret. Add this line to `.env.scheduler`:

vault entry, kahip-fahaf: VAULT_KEY13=d5e3c8a8a976c

Runbook fragment — ledger archiving. Quick one for the office manager: the old paper ledgers from the Pinfold Street branch are boxed up in the copy room, twelve boxes total, all sealed and numbered. They're headed to the Greyharbour archive via a Swiftmere courier on Wednesday. Check the box count against the list before anything leaves the building. Then pass the driver this confidential instruction:

handover note for yagef-bagep: the drudor pelius courier leaves the kasdor zorvan norir ledger at gate 8016 under passcode 755406

Subject: Handover — CatalogCache invalidation

Hi Verna,

Passing the baton before I'm out next week. The ShelfWise product catalog still uses the old fan-out invalidation, so stale prices can linger up to 90 seconds after a merchant edit. The fix is staged behind the purge-v2 toggle — please eyeball the audit hooks before we flip it. Release bundles for the purge service have to be signed or the edge nodes drop them. Current signing key follows:

deploy key for yajop-fahop: bky3_h1v

**Q: Where are the search relevance tuning notes kept?**

All boost weights, synonym lists, and A/B results for the Wrenmoor search stack live in the `relevance-notes` folder of the search repo. Update the changelog whenever you adjust field boosts. Questions about past tuning decisions can be sent to the address below.

escalation mailbox, hahof-fahag: istwyn.prawyn@qirvanlabs.internal